Commission considers $150K in small business relief Jan. 26

Buncombe County seal

While county relief has heretofore been available only in the form of low-interest loans, businesses will now be able to seek grants of $5,000 to hire or rehire employees at a living wage. Staff had previously believed such a grant program to be illegal but had since received updated guidance from the UNC School of Government.

Total individual donations grow 65% in annual campaign for good

Mountain Xpress’ 2020 Give!Local campaign to raise funds and awareness for 44 community nonprofits wrapped up on Dec. 31 as the most successful to date. The sixth annual effort saw 570 individual donors give a total of $233,564, a 65% increase over the previous year’s total of $141,207 from 400 donors. 2020’s impact was boosted … Read more
